Understanding Epilepsy: A Structure for Advocacy

What is Epilepsy?

Epilepsy is defined as a chronic condition characterized by unexpected, recurring seizures. These seizures result from irregular electric activity in the brain and can differ considerably in extent and period. Comprehending this condition is critical for anybody seeking to advocate effectively.

Types of Seizures

Seizures are classified right into 2 primary kinds: focal and generalised.

    Focal Seizures: These come from one area of the mind and can be additional categorized into basic and intricate seizures. Generalized Seizures: These entail both hemispheres of the brain from onset.

Knowing these distinctions assists support workers supply customized aid based upon individual needs.

Seizure Management Techniques

Support employees need to grasp numerous seizure monitoring techniques to react efficiently during an episode.

Seizure First Aid Tips

Stay tranquility; make sure the person is safe. Time the period of the seizure. Do not limit activities or area objects in the mouth. Position them safely after the seizure ends.
